Churches Should Try TikTok Trends

Trends on TikTok last almost as long as the videos themselves. The nature of TikTok allows for sounds, dances, challenges, and more to trend easily. The most important thing about TikTok trends is that you must be active on the app to know what’s trending. Like all things, these trends will come and go, but if your church can be ahead of them, they are a great way to reach new viewers. Within the app, TikTok compiles videos using the same sound together. For example, if there’s a trending dance that uses the same song, users are able to click on the video and find every other TikTok made with that sound. This means that your church could be found by someone with zero connection to you, other than the video you posted on TikTok! The same thing applies to hashtags and challenges themselves. TikTok trends open the door to having fun, reaching new audiences, and most of the time, dancing a little!

Use The Algorithm

TikTok for Churches

While trends are a great way to reach new audiences and popularize your content, it’s also important to maintain your church branding and mission. Like other platforms, users are free to follow whoever they like to see their content. But unlike Facebook and Instagram, TikTok never runs out of content to watch, because it tailors a user’s feed to their preferences. Using AI, TikTok compiles the topics and types of videos a user likes to watch to create a curated feed of their preferences. This creates really specific niche content. For your church, this means maintaining clear branding and a consistent niche allows you to reach audiences that care about what you’re posting.

8 TikTok Post Ideas for Churches

Starting anything new can be intimidating, so we’re providing a few post ideas to get your church started on TikTok! Check them out below!

Sermon Snippets

Posting a short, impactful, and engaging portion of your pastor’s recent teaching is an awesome piece of content for TikTok. Sermon Snippets simplify TikTok because they don’t require you to film or edit any additional content! They’re easy to post and create a lasting impact.

Scripture Memory Challenge

Challenge your audience by posting a verse each week for them to memorize and then duet, repeating the verse back to your original TikTok is a fun way to get your audience involved!

Offer Topical Support

People may not always be searching for sermons, but they’re definitely searching for topical support. Record a series of short videos offering support for common concerns in your community. For example, offer tips for marriage, forgiveness, singleness, parenting, and spiritual growth.

Dance Challenge

Get your students moving by inviting your youth ministries to film popular TikTok dances. This is a fun way to invite youth participation and allow them to see your church in a new way.

Start a Series

Short videos work best on TikTok, but if you’d like to post a longer video, that’s totally okay! Instead of posting the entire long video, post it in multiple split clips. Creating a series of connected content will give you even more videos to post!

Watch What Your Members Post

One of the best ways to brainstorm and come up with new ideas is to look at the styles and types of videos your members are already posting on TikTok. This research reveals the type of content they already like!

Respond to your Congregation

Like and comment on the TikToks of the people in your congregation. One reason people post on TikTok is to be seen, heard, and valued. Your church can easily encourage the people in your congregation by liking and engaging with their content.

Share a “Behind the Scenes” Post

Pastors, worship leaders, children pastors, and any other church staff members should consider posting some sort of “behind the scenes” TikTok. These TikToks can show the band practicing,  pastors preparing for the service, or even the pastor practicing the sermon. TikToks like this can show true authenticity.

Church Advertising on TikTok

Churches have the ability to advertise on TikTok. However, it’s important to understand the strengths/weaknesses of every platform in order to align your expectations. TikTok ads can not be geo-targeted locally so they’re not as effective for event advertising. Instead, churches could consider using TikTok advertising to generally promote their church and sermon content. If your church is looking to grow its online presence through increased content views, TikTok could be one way to grow a younger audience. However, because it is relatively new, it will cost more than other similar platforms like Google and Facebook.
